Description

Rule your kitchen with fire and blood! This regal collection of 60 recipes will bring Westerosi cuisine to your table, with dishes like sweet pumpkin soup, royal boar ribs, and stuffed baked apples. Inspired by House of the Dragon, Game of Thrones, and George R. R. Martin’s beloved novels, this cookbook will serve you well in all your culinary adventures.  

Feast of the Dragon includes 60 recipes inspired by the world of Westeros, from Honey Cake to Arya’s Pilfered Tartlets to Tyroshi’s Pear Brandy. Fans will enjoy this cookbook’s multitude of easy-to-follow recipes and stunning photography, transporting them into this vast fantasy world.

With Feast of the Dragons, fans will be able to pick from a wide variety of food and drinks inspired by the books and television series. From Sansa’s Lemon Cake and the House Lannister Golden Roast to the titular Blood Red Wedding Cake, follow your favorite characters and moments through a culinary excursion through this gripping fictional world.

About the Author

Tom Grimm, born in 1972, apprenticed as a bookseller and has been working ever since as an author, translator, screenwriter, journalist, editor, and producer for a number of international publishers. Alongside his enthusiasm for literature, movies, and video games, he especially enjoys amusement parks, travel, listening to Rammstein, good food, bad jokes, and firing up the grill year-round. He is a passionate amateur cook, although not much of a baker. Even so, he has managed to win the Gourmand World Cookbook Award and other distinctions for his work. Tom lives with his family, a literal pride of cats, and several life-size images of Batman, Kung Fu Panda, Rayman, and Thrall the Orc. He lives and works in a small town in the west of Germany that is really and truly nothing to write home about. (Not kidding. Really.)
